Summary

Following Day 1 of minicamp, Jacksonville Jaguars head coach Liam Coen provided insight into the offensive line's current status. Despite the absence of pads limiting physical evaluation, Coen expressed satisfaction with the depth of the unit, which has remained unchanged from last season while adding draft pick Emmanuel Pregnon. He noted the importance of chemistry and competition for playing time, especially with recent draft picks like Pregnon and Wyatt Milum potentially vying for roles. Improvement is needed in the run game, as the Jaguars ranked 27th in rushing yards last season. Coen highlighted the importance of establishing a solid run game to aid the offense moving forward. The team is set to continue evaluations as they move to padded practices.
